The Value of Gold Wedding Bands

Gold wedding bands have been a traditional symbol of marriage for centuries, and their value goes beyond just the price tag. These timeless pieces of jewelry hold sentimental value and represent the commitment and love between two individuals. When it comes to the question “how much is a gold wedding band,” the answer can vary depending on factors such as the purity of the gold, design intricacy, and brand.

Factors Affecting :

  • Gold Purity: The value of a gold wedding band is greatly influenced by the purity of the gold used. 24 karat gold is the purest form, while 10 karat gold contains a lower percentage of gold, making it less valuable.
  • Design Complexity: The intricacy of the design can also impact the value of the wedding band. Intricately designed bands may come with a higher price tag due to the amount of craftsmanship involved.
  • Brand: The reputation and brand of the jeweler can also influence the pricing of a gold wedding band. Well-known and reputable brands may charge more for their products.

Gold Wedding Band Price Range:

Gold Purity Price Range
10k Gold $200 – $800
14k Gold $500 – $2000
18k Gold $800 – $3000

Factors Affecting the Cost

Gold wedding bands are a symbol of eternal love and commitment, but how much does a gold wedding band actually cost? The price of a gold wedding band can vary depending on several factors. Understanding these factors can help you make an informed decision when shopping for the perfect ring for your special day.

One of the primary of a gold wedding band is the karat of the gold. Gold comes in various purities, with 24-karat gold being the purest. However, 24-karat gold is also the softest and most malleable, making it less suitable for everyday wear. As a result, lower karat gold, such as 14-karat or 18-karat, is often used for wedding bands. The higher the karat, the more expensive the gold wedding band is likely to be.

Another factor that can impact the cost of a gold wedding band is the design and craftsmanship. Intricate designs and custom details can drive up the price of a wedding band. Additionally, the weight and thickness of the band can also affect the cost. Thicker and heavier bands typically use more gold, resulting in a higher price tag. Budget-Friendly Alternatives to Traditional Gold Bands

Comparison of Gold Wedding Bands and Budget-Friendly Alternatives

Material Durability Price Range
Traditional Gold Band Less durable, prone to scratches and dents $$-$$$
Sterling Silver Durable, may tarnish over time $
Titanium Highly durable, scratch-resistant $
Tungsten Carbide Extremely durable, scratch-resistant $

Q&A

Q: How much should I expect to spend on a gold wedding band?
A: The cost of a gold wedding band can vary depending on factors such as the purity of the gold, the design of the band, and the retailer you purchase it from.

Q: What is the average price range for a gold wedding band?
A: On average, a simple gold wedding band can cost anywhere from $200 to $1,200, but more elaborate designs and higher purity gold can push the price higher.

Q: Are there any cost-saving options for purchasing a gold wedding band?
A: Absolutely! One option is to opt for a lower purity gold, such as 14K instead of 18K, which can decrease the price of the band. You can also shop around and compare prices at different retailers to find the best deal.

Q: Are there any additional costs to consider when purchasing a gold wedding band?
A: Yes, it’s important to factor in the cost of engraving, resizing, and any warranties or insurance for your wedding band. These additional costs can vary depending on the retailer and the specific services you require.

Q: Is it worth investing in a more expensive gold wedding band?
A: Investing in a higher quality gold wedding band, such as 18K gold, can ensure that the band remains durable and beautiful for years to come. While the initial cost may be higher, the long-term value and durability of the band make it a worthwhile investment.

Q: What are some ways to find a reputable and affordable retailer for a gold wedding band?
A: Researching online reviews, asking for recommendations from friends and family, and visiting multiple retailers to compare prices and quality are all effective ways to find a reputable and affordable retailer for your gold wedding band.
